Stephen C. Cosenza has authored 55 papers that have received a total of 1.9k indexed citations.
This includes 29 papers in Molecular Biology, 26 papers in Oncology and 12 papers in Organic Chemistry. The topics of these papers are Cancer-related Molecular Pathways (12 papers), Advanced Breast Cancer Therapies (8 papers) and Microtubule and mitosis dynamics (8 papers). Stephen C. Cosenza is often cited by papers focused on Cancer-related Molecular Pathways (12 papers), Advanced Breast Cancer Therapies (8 papers) and Microtubule and mitosis dynamics (8 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in United States and Spain. Stephen C. Cosenza's co-authors include E. Premkumar Reddy, M. V. Ramana Reddy, Muralidhar R. Mallireddigari, Kenneth J. Soprano and Venkat R. Pallela and has published in prestigious journals such as Science, Cell and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ences.
